Handicap bathtub installation services involve modifying or replacing existing bathtubs to improve accessibility and safety for individuals with mobility challenges. These services typically include the installation of walk-in tubs, low-threshold entrances, grab bars, and non-slip surfaces to reduce the risk of slips and falls. The process may also involve adjusting the height of the bathtub or installing supportive seating to accommodate users with limited mobility or balance issues. The goal is to create a bathing environment that allows for easier entry, exit, and use while maintaining comfort and independence.
These services address common problems such as difficulty stepping over traditional tub walls, instability while bathing, and the risk of accidents in the bathroom. For seniors or those recovering from injuries or surgeries, standard bathtubs can pose significant safety hazards. Handicap bathtub installations help mitigate these issues by providing safer, more accessible bathing options. Additionally, they can enhance the overall safety of the bathroom, preventing injuries and promoting confidence for users who may otherwise avoid bathing due to safety concerns.

Cost Range for Bathtub Replacement - The typical cost for installing a handicap bathtub varies from approximately $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the bathtub model and installation complexity. Basic models tend to be on the lower end, while custom or high-end options increase the price.
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s for handicap bathtub installation generally range between $500 and $1,500. Factors influencing costs include the existing plumbing setup and any necessary modifications to the bathroom space.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include removing an old bathtub, which can be $200 to $600, and any necessary plumbing or electrical work, potentially adding another $300 to $1,000. These vary based on the project's scope and local labor rates.
Overall Project Budget - The total expense for handicap bathtub installation typically falls between $2,000 and $7,000.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s and bathroom layouts.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of handicap bathtub installation? Handicap bathtub installation can improve safety, accessibility, and independence for individuals with mobility challenges by providing easier entry and exit options.
How long does a handicap bathtub installation typically take? The duration of installation varies depending on the specific project and existing bathroom setup, but it gener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.
Are there different types of handicap bathtubs available? Yes, there are various options including walk-in tubs, low-threshold tubs, and tubs with built-in seating to accommodate different needs and preferences.
What should be considered before installing a handicap bathtub? Factors such as bathroom space, plumbing compatibility, user mobility needs, and safety features should be considered before installation.
